The Caspian Sea itself is the largest enclosed inland body of water on Earth, boasting a unique ecosystem and diverse marine life. Along the Iranian coastline, visitors can expect stunning views of the sea, dotted with vibrant fishing villages like Bandar Anzali and Babolsar, where traditional boats sway gently in the harbor.
With its moderate climate, the Caspian Sea coast enjoys warm summers and mild winters, making it a year-round destination for leisure seekers. The lush green hills and expansive beaches create the perfect backdrop for relaxing strolls, invigorating hikes, and peaceful seaside picnics. Popular beaches such as Kiashahr Beach and Ramsar Beach offer pristine sandy shores, making them ideal spots for sunbathing or enjoying a quiet moment while listening to the gentle waves.
For those interested in nature, the coastal region is home to several national parks and protected areas, including the Hyrcanian Forests, a UNESCO World Heritage site. These dense forests are teeming with diverse flora and fauna, providing opportunities for hiking and wildlife watching. Birdwatchers will be particularly enamored with the area, as it serves as a migratory path for various bird species throughout the year.
